Decision Time delves into the intricate world of choices and their profound impact on our lives. Laurence Alison and Neil Shortland present readers with a captivating exploration of decision-making processes, merging psychological insights with real-world applications. Through engaging narratives and relatable examples, they demonstrate how seemingly small decisions can dramatically shape our futures, urging readers to reflect critically on their own choices.
The authors break down the complexities of human behavior and cognition, offering practical strategies that guide readers towards making informed, purposeful decisions. By highlighting the importance of understanding personal biases and external influences, the book empowers individuals to navigate life's challenges with confidence. It serves not only as a manual for effective decision-making but also as a source of inspiration for those looking to take control of their paths. This thought-provoking read encourages self-awareness and proactive engagement with the pivotal moments that define our lives.
